"i have done that in the past, it usually takes  me weeks to feel like i'm used to the habit of doing something."  I'd like to point out, even if you get used to it and starts to form into a habit, life has a way of making us relax and become complacent. And then we start to neglect those things we accomplished.

A Core Balance Chore is a chore you maintain faithfully, not because it's a habit but because it's something, you keep done, regardless of external deterants because it helps you feel accomplished on some level. It MAY turn ito a habit but most of the time it's more about just doing it because it's important to you. A series of these tasks has helped me feel more balanced. Like you said, "Just start with one thing". And plan on doing it forever because we all like clean clothe's, not just for a couple of weeks.
